Employers are re-thinking experience requirements amid the labor shortage

Leoforce

In July of 2021 alone , over four million Americans quit their jobs, with a large portion represented by mid-career workers aged 30-45. This demographic is showing an increase in resignations of about 20% compared to 2020. These numbers tell a story about cultural changes taking place for employee and employer relationships.

4 Tips for hiring and retaining Gen Z talent

Manatal

Gen Z is estimated to make up between 34% to 40% of the global workforce by the end of 2020, making them one of the more important demographics for the workplace. Channels such as job boards and LinkedIn listings are very effective, but Gen Z has a passion for social media that surpasses any other generation.
